Buttermilk scones (recipes)








Makes About 14



Preparation time

less than 30 mins



Cooking time

10 to 30 mins

















Ingredients



220g/8oz plain flour1 level tsp bicarbonate of soda¼ tsp salt45g/1½oz unsalted butter1 tbsp golden syrup or golden caster sugarabout 185ml/7fl oz buttermilk or soured creammilk, for glazing



Method



1. Preheat the oven to 200C/400F/Gas 6.2. Sift the flour with the bicarbonate of soda and the salt into a bowl. Rub in the butter.3. Make a well in the centre and add the syrup or sugar and enough buttermilk or cream to make a soft but not sticky dough.4. Pat or roll out, on a floured surface, to a thickness of 1.5cm/0.5 inch.5. Use a 5cm/2.5 inch biscuit cutter to stamp out rounds, lay them on a floured baking sheet and brush the tops with a little milk.6. Bake for about ten minutes until well risen and lightly browned.7. Serve still warm with clotted cream, or butter, and jam.
